Crispy Cauliflower Crust Buffalo Chicken Pizza
Enjoy a lighter twist on classic pizza with a crispy cauliflower crust topped with spicy buffalo chicken, melty low-fat mozzarella, and a hint of Parmesan. This recipe balances flavor and macros perfectly, delivering a satisfying crunch, zesty heat, and a protein punch to fuel your day.
INGREDIENTS
200g Cauliflower
1 large Egg White
2 tbsp Almond Flour
2 tbsp Parmesan Cheese
3 oz Cooked Chicken Breast
2 tbsp Buffalo Sauce
1/4 cup shredded Low-Fat Mozzarella Cheese
PREPARATION
Preheat your oven to 425°F and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
Process the cauliflower in a food processor until it resembles rice. Steam or microwave until tender, then place in a clean towel and squeeze out excess moisture.
In a bowl, combine the cauliflower, egg white, almond flour, and Parmesan cheese. Mix until well combined to form a dough-like consistency.
Spread the cauliflower mixture onto the prepared baking sheet, shaping it into a thin, even round crust.
Bake the crust for 15-20 minutes until it starts to turn golden and firm up.
Remove from the oven and evenly spread the buffalo sauce over the crust.
Distribute the cooked chicken breast pieces over the sauce.
Sprinkle the shredded low-fat mozzarella cheese on top.
Return the pizza to the oven and bake for an additional 8-10 minutes until the cheese is melted and the edges are crispy.
Allow the pizza to cool for a few minutes before slicing and serving.
